The opening comment mark '/**' is used for highlighting the beginning of kernel-doc comments. There are certain files in arch/x86/platform/intel-quark, which follow this syntax, but the content inside does not comply with kernel-doc. Such lines were probably not meant for kernel-doc parsing, but are parsed due to the presence of kernel-doc like comment syntax(i.e, '/**'), which causes unexpected warnings from kernel-doc. E.g., presence of kernel-doc like comment in the header lines for arch/x86/platform/intel-quark/imr.c causes these warnings: "warning: Function parameter or member 'fmt' not described in 'pr_fmt'" "warning: expecting prototype for c(). Prototype was for pr_fmt() instead" Similarly for arch/x86/platform/intel-quark/imr_selftest.c too. Provide a simple fix by replacing these occurrences with general comment format, i.e. '/*', to prevent kernel-doc from parsing it.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
